The Department of Justice, through the Federal Bureau of Prisons at FCI McDowell, is soliciting bids for subsistence supplies for the second quarter of fiscal year 2026. This procurement is exclusively set aside for small businesses and requires bidders to provide a variety of food items, including canned goods, grains, meats, dairy products, and disposable food service items, all adhering to specific quality and packaging standards. The selected contractor will be evaluated based on past performance, socio-economic status, overall price, and delivery schedule, with a strong emphasis on past performance and compliance with product specifications. The Federal Bureau of Prisons, Federal Correctional Institution McDowell, issued RFQ 15B12226Q00000002 for subsistence. Submissions are due by 9:00 A.M. EST on December 18, 2025. Offerors must ensure all products have a 90-day shelf life from delivery and complete Representations and Certifications via SAM.gov, complying with FAR 52.204-7 and 52.204-6. Bidders must complete specific blocks on SF 1449, including original signatures. Awards will be made by line item to the lowest responsive/responsible bidder. Bids must not alter item descriptions or unit of issue, or include limiting phrases, as such changes can lead to rejection and impact past performance records. All prices must be FOB destination, with deliveries accepted weekly at FCI McDowell Warehouse. Submissions can be mailed, hand-carried, faxed to 304-436-7389, or emailed to jriffe@bop.gov. The FCI McDowell facility in Welch, WV, is soliciting bids for a wide array of food supplies, including various canned goods (garbanzo beans, kidney beans, diced tomatoes, crushed tomatoes, jalapenos, spinach, tuna), grains (rice, rolled oats), pasta (macaroni, rotini, spaghetti), cereals (bran flakes), dressings (ranch, mayonnaise), condiments (yellow mustard, hot sauce, Worcestershire sauce, ketchup), snack items (tortilla chips, potato chips), taco-related products (taco shells, taco seasoning), spices (lemon pepper, chili powder blend, cumin, paprika, Cajun seasoning), soup bases (beef, chicken, vegetable flavors), meats (ground beef, beef patties, beef roast, chicken thighs, chicken leg quarters, breaded chicken fillets, pork roast, fish fillets, frankfurters, Italian sausage, turkey roast, ground turkey), dairy (cheddar cheese, mozzarella cheese), and baking mixes (chocolate cake mix, yellow cake mix). The RFP also includes disposable items such as paper bags, three-compartment food trays with lids, and sporks with napkins. Bidders are reminded to include case weight on all submissions and adhere to specific product requirements, including CID specifications, USDA grades, and packaging details, with some items requiring Kosher Parve certification.
